The General Library has a rich collection of books, journals, and e-resources to support the teaching, research, and extension programs of the college and provides efficient and effective service to the students and faculty.

The library is technology-enabled and bar-coded all its operations using Library Management Software. It provider a wider range of reach to a common digital library for sciences and humanities, subscription to digital databases.

The library plays an important role in promoting information and knowledge and provides access to a wide collection of 14,000 books, e-resources, and NPTEL Web and Video lectures. The digital library of the college offers the latest online resources like e-books, e-journals, and e-databases for reference through remote access.

  • GENERAL LIBRARY opens to all the Teaching, Non Teaching faculty, and students.
  • The Library works from 8.45 am to 6.30 pm on all working days
  • Book Issue and Return Timing from 10.00 am to 5.45 pm.
  • Students entry and exit registered by their Board-coded ID card.
  • Students’ belongings should be kept in the place allocated.
  • Mobile phones and other devices should be kept in silent mode.
  • Books should be Return without scribbling. If any damage to the returned book student should replace the same book.
  • Reference books, journals, back volumes, project reports, etc, will be in the Reference section.
